Pelatiah

Simeonite leader

Simeonite captain who led five hundred men to Mount Seir under King Hezekiah, defeating the Amalekites who had settled there.

Who or what is this?

Pelatiah son of Ishi was a captain of the Simeonites, mentioned in 1 Chronicles 4 in connection with a military expedition during the reign of king of . He led five hundred Simeonite warriors to , where they defeated the remnant of the who had taken refuge there, and his people settled in the region in their place. He is one of four named captains who led this campaign, and he appears only in this passage.
